What’s Different?
Changes for 2021 – Live Event and Virtual Event!
- To ensure health and safety for all, the CPC’s plan will adhere to social distancing recommendations by limiting attendance at the sessions held in the Ocean City Convention Center to 400 attendees.
- The Parade of Flags will transition to a Municipal Showcase, a montage of videos provided by each city/town. It will be shown repeatedly at the live and virtual events.
- The Business Meeting and Cabinet Secretaries Roundtable will be part of the virtual event.
Changes for 2021 – Registration Update!
- You may register for both the live and virtual event or the virtual only event. Two choices.
- Registration for the live event also includes the virtual event registration, BOGO!
- IMPORTANT: To give all municipalities a chance to participate in the limited attendance live event, only two representatives from each municipality can register in the first three weeks registration is open.
- Each municipality can determine which two representatives to send to the live component.
- Registration for Summer Conference will open March 5. Initial 3-week period ends March 26.
- After March 26, everyone may register for the live event until the maximum attendance of 400 is reached.
- Virtual conference registrations only include the virtual event and can be completed anytime.
- Full registration will include one ticket to each lunch and both receptions along with live and virtual access to over 20 educational sessions.
- Spouses/guests are not able to attend live conference sessions, workshops, or Expo in 2021 because of limited capacities and social distancing. Guests may attend the Welcome and Closing receptions. Tickets for these events must be purchased prior to the conference on the registration from.
- Live event spouse/guest registration option is not available in 2021.
- Event tickets and on-site registrations for the live portion will not be availalble on-site.
Changes for 2021 - Live Event With Social Distancing Safety
- Attendees will be split into two groups. Each group will attend sessions in rotation. First group will attend workshop 1,2,3 first, then the second group will attend those same sessions later in the day.
- ONLY registered attendees and exhibitors will be allowed in the Ocean City Convention Center.
- All lunches and receptions will be ticketed events.
- All attendees will have the same workshop opportunities for the live event, with three choices for each session.
- Affiliate, Department and Chapter meetings cannot occur during the regular conference hours.
- Children/guests will not be allowed in the expo hall
- A Welcome Reception will kick off the live event on Sunday evening at the Clarion Hotel – both indoor and outside space will help keep us safe!
- A Closing Reception will be held at the Princess Royale Hotel – again, indoors and outdoors. A Banquet dinner is not possible for 2021
- A phone, tablet, electronic device will be required to access conference information. No program or handouts will be available. Bring your charger.
